Key Ceremony Checklist — Item 7 (Marrowstone ORM refactor)

Before sealing the new signing keys for the refactored ORM layer, confirm that all legacy mapper modules have been re-pointed to the Marrowstone schema registry and that no adapter still references the retired credential store. Two witnesses must initial the ceremony log. The final step re-encrypts the migration archive, which prompts for the ceremony recovery passphrase; that value is noted immediately below.

vault phrase of tajeg-tageg = pelix-druix-holius-briael-zorwyn-frawyn-fraox-norok-drueth-aldiel

Hey Priya — handing over the validator plugin work on Castellan. Each validator registers via the plugin manifest; load order matters, so don't shuffle them. New folks: start with the NullCheck plugin, it's the simplest. Tests live under plugins/spec. The full plugin authoring guide is on our internal wiki here.

dashboard of bawif-bawep = https://grafana.lumiccorp.corp/spaces/display/pages/59df1b902784

Scope: release manager reference for the metrics-aggregation sidecar shipped with every Harborline service pod. Required vars: FUNNEL_FLUSH_INTERVAL (seconds, default 30), FUNNEL_BUFFER_MAX (datapoints), FUNNEL_UPSTREAM_HOST, and FUNNEL_COMPRESSION (gzip or none). Optional: FUNNEL_DEBUG for verbose flush logs; keep it off in production. Validate with `funnelctl check` before cutting a release tag. The sidecar also needs write access to the aggregation endpoint, and its credential is set on the next line.

vault entry, yahif-yajep: COURIER_KEY29=b802bdf8034096b65a51c6ba5abe2

## Runbook — Pixelwash EXIF Scrub

Pixelwash strips EXIF metadata from uploads before your plugin sees them. If scrubbed images arrive with GPS tags intact, the scrub worker is bypassing your hook; check your manifest priority. To test locally, run the worker against the sandbox bucket. The worker's env file needs the sandbox credential on the next line.

sealed setting: ARCHIVE_KEY3=8d0